[§76-22.6] Recruitment; minimum qualification review; state departments, divisions, and agencies. (a) Notwithstanding any other law to the contrary, a state department, division, or agency, rather than the department of human resources development, may conduct a minimum qualification review of applicants for vacant positions within that department, division, or agency.

(b) A state department, division, or agency that elects to conduct its own minimum qualification review of applicants for a vacancy pursuant to subsection (a) shall notify the department of human resources development, which shall provide to the department, division, or agency:

(c) Upon completing the minimum qualification review of applicants for a vacancy, the state department, division, or agency shall submit to the department of human resources development the applications for individuals who have met the minimum qualifications for the vacancy; provided that the state department, division, or agency may immediately begin interviewing applicants that have been determined to meet the minimum qualifications for the vacant position. The department of human resources development shall complete any other tasks necessary to facilitate the hiring of the applicants, including auditing and correcting any errors found in the minimum qualification review, as applicable; provided further that if any errors are found, the department of human resources development shall have five working days to correct the error and notify the state department, division, or agency.
